Focus your expansion
Businesses attempting to expand should not suddenly change the direction of their business operations. Focus on expanding the products and services currently offered since starting a brand new venture too soon could put your business at risk.

Try channel marketing
Join forces with another business that has access the same types of customers that would be interested in what you have to offer. It's a win-win situation since you can each help one another by promoting the other's products or services.

Business operations are the day-to-day actions of a business and its employees. In order to have business operations that run smoothly, a business must have all of its priorities in order. All aspects of a business come into play in business operations including human resource issues, finances and interactions with the consumer. To be successful, business operations should work to produce reoccurring income and a tangible value for any investors in the business.

Bylaws
Bylaws are the rules and regulations a business creates to govern itself. Bylaws include specific regulations for the board of directors, shareholders and officers of a company.

Chief financial officer (CFO)
The chief financial officer (CFO) holds a similar position in the company as a CEO, but the CFO deals solely with the financial aspect of business operations, from budgeting to maintenance of accounting practices.

Chief executive officer (CEO)
The chief executive officer is responsible for setting the direction of a company. The CEO helps to develop strategies and goals for a successful future. The CEO is also often the face of a company, promoting and defending the major decisions of any business.

Bridge financing
Bridge financing is a way that a company can get intermediate financing for the time in between major projects, or to generate cash flow before a business goes public.

Business license
A business license is a document that authorizes a business to conduct operations. A business license can be issued by local or state government licensing offices.

Back office operations
Back office operations are the areas of a business that help to support distribution and delivery of the products or services the business sells.
